Locating Perfect Internet Address Sales

So, you've got a valuable domain name you're ready to part with? Excellent! Several avenues exist for moving your digital asset. You can explore large marketplaces like Sedo, GoDaddy Auctions, and Flippa, which offer broad visibility to potential investors. Alternatively, consider engaging a specialized domain name broker. These agents possess deep industry understanding and a network of serious purchasers, often achieving a better value for your domain. Still, brokers typically charge a fee, so weigh the anticipated gains against the associated costs. You can even offer your domain on smaller, focused platforms, though anticipate smaller exposure. Finally, the optimal choice depends on your desired outcome and comfort level.
